Hello Magento Friends,
When any product is out of stock then the price is not displayed on the product detail page and category page in Magento 2. But If you want to display it for your customers then you have to apply the code. Let’s learn Magento 2: How to Show Price of "out of stock" Products.
Checkout Steps: Magento 2: Show Out of Stock Product Price in Product Detail Page and Category Page